13(1)Without prejudice to the provisions of paragraphs 7 to 12 of this Schedule, any transaction effected between a transferor and a transferee in pursuance of paragraph 1(5) or of a direction under paragraph 1(7) of this Schedule shall be binding on all other persons, and notwithstanding that it would, apart from this sub-paragraph, have required the consent or concurrence of any other person.U.K.

(2)It shall be the duty of the transferor and transferee, if they effect any transaction in pursuance of the said paragraph 1(5) or a direction under the said paragraph 1(7), to notify any person who has rights or liabilities which thereby become enforceable as to part by or against the transferor and as to part by or against the transferee, and if such a person applies to the Minister and satisfies him that the transaction operated unfairly against him the Minister may give such directions to the transferor and the transferee as appear to him appropriate for varying the transaction.

(3)If in consequence of a transfer to which this Schedule applies or of anything done in pursuance of the provisions of this Schedule the rights or liabilities of any person other than one of the Boards or new authorities or a wholly-owned subsidiary thereof which were enforceable against or by the transferor become enforceable as to part against or by the transferor and as to part against or by the transferee, and the value of any property or interest of that person is thereby diminished, such compensation as may be just shall be paid to that person by the transferor, the transferee or both, and any dispute as to whether and if so how much compensation is so payable, or as to the person to whom it shall be paid, shall be referred to and determined by an arbitrator appointed by the Lord Chancellor or, where the proceedings are to be held in Scotland, by an arbiter appointed by the Lord President of the Court of Session.

(4)Where the transferor or the transferee under a transfer to which this Schedule applies purports by any conveyance or transfer to transfer to some person other than one of the Boards or new authorities or a wholly-owned subsidiary thereof for consideration any land or any other property which before the transfer date belonged to the transferor, or which is an interest in property which before that date belonged to the transferor, the conveyance or transfer shall be as effective as if both the transferor and the transferee had been parties thereto and had thereby conveyed or transferred all their interest in the property conveyed or transferred.

(5)If at any stage of any court proceedings to which the transferor or transferee under a transfer to which this Schedule applies and a person other than one of the Boards or new authorities or a wholly-owned subsidiary thereof are parties, it appears to the court that the issues in the proceedings depend on the identification or definition of any of the property, rights or liabilities transferred which the transferor and the transferee have not yet effected, or to raise a question of construction on the relevant provisions of this Act which would not arise if the transferor and the transferee constituted a single person, the court may, if it thinks fit on the application of a party to the proceedings other than such a body as aforesaid, hear and determine the proceedings on the footing that such one of the transferor and the transferee as is a party to the proceedings represents and is answerable for the other of them, and that the transferor and the transferee constitute a single person, and any judgment or order given by the courts, shall bind both the transferor and the transferee accordingly.

(6)It shall be the duty of the transferor and the transferee under any transfer to which this Schedule applies to keep one another informed of any case where either of them may be prejudiced by sub-paragraph (4) or (5) of this paragraph, and if either the transferor or the transferee claims that he has been so prejudiced and that the other of them ought to indemnify or make a payment to him on that account and has unreasonably failed to meet that claim, he may refer the matter to the Minister for determination by the Minister.
